Explore Lalibela, Ethiopia: A Journey Through History and Culture!
Nestled in the heart of the Amhara region, Lalibela is a UNESCO World Heritage site renowned for its remarkable rock-hewn churches, which date back to the 12th century. This extraordinary town is often referred to as the "New Jerusalem" due to its historical and religious significance. Visitors flock to Lalibela to witness the stunning architecture and immerse themselves in the rich cultural heritage of Ethiopia.

Cultural & Historical Significance
The rock-hewn churches of Lalibela, including the famous Church of St. George, are not only architectural marvels but also serve as active places of worship. These churches are a testament to Ethiopia's rich Christian heritage and attract pilgrims from around the world. The annual Ethiopian Orthodox celebrations bring the town to life, showcasing traditional music, dance, and vibrant local culture.
